Bitcoin gambling platforms have grown rapidly, driven by the promise of transparent and decentralized betting. However, with this growth comes significant security challenges. Understanding the common security pitfalls and implementing best practices are vital for both platform operators and users to protect their funds and trust. This article explores the most frequent vulnerabilities within Bitcoin gambling ecosystems and offers strategies to mitigate these risks effectively.

How Insecure Wallet Storage Can Lead to User Fund Losses

Risks of Centralized Wallet Management

Many cryptocurrency gambling platforms utilize centralized wallets, where all user funds are stored in a single or few large wallets managed by the platform. This approach simplifies management but introduces a significant security risk. If these wallets are not secured properly, hackers can exploit vulnerabilities to drain extensive funds in one attack. For example, in 2013, a rogue insider exploited centralized control over an exchange’s hot wallets, resulting in losses amounting to millions of dollars.

Decentralization and multi-signature wallets are effective strategies. They distribute control across multiple keys, reducing the impact of a single point of failure. Platforms adopting multi-signature wallets have shown greater resilience against hacking attempts.

Implications of Poor Private Key Security

The private keys to digital wallets are the core security element. Loss or theft of private keys directly equates to losing access to funds. Users often fall victim due to weak private key management—storing keys insecurely on local devices, sharing keys, or using unencrypted backups.

Weak Private Key Management Practice Potential Consequence
Storing keys on compromised devices Private key theft
Using predictable or weak passwords to encrypt private keys Brute-force attacks succeed
Failing to create secure backups or storing them insecurely Loss of access after device failure

Research by the Crypto Security Institute indicates that over 60% of wallet breaches are due to insecure private key storage practices.

Best Practices for Secure Digital Wallet Storage

  • Use hardware wallets, which store private keys offline, providing an isolated environment resistant to hacking.
  • Implement multi-signature schemes requiring multiple approvals for fund transfers.
  • Encrypt private keys with strong passwords and store backups in secure, geographically dispersed locations.
  • Avoid sharing private keys or seed phrases; educate users on CWE (Common Weakness Enumeration) standards.

Adopting these practices significantly reduces the risk of unauthorized access and fund loss.

Vulnerabilities in Transaction Verification Processes

Manipulation of Bet Records and Outcomes

One critical vulnerability in gambling systems is the manipulation of betting records and outcomes. If the platform’s server controls the outcome generation process or if the data integrity isn’t maintained, users can be cheated. For instance, some platforms may alter bet results in real-time, skewing payouts unfairly.

“Ensuring transparency in transaction records is crucial. Without it, trust diminishes, and vulnerabilities can be exploited.”

Impact of Flawed Hashing and Encryption Methods

Cryptographic techniques such as hashing and encryption are integral to verifying transaction integrity. However, the use of outdated or weak algorithms—like MD5 hashing or plain RSA encryption—can be exploited by attackers to forge or alter data. For example, in 2012, several gambling sites suffered from hash collisions when they used weak hashing algorithms, allowing attackers to manipulate bet records.

Strategies to Ensure Transaction Integrity

  • Implement cryptographically secure algorithms like SHA-256 for hashing and AES-256 for encryption.
  • Use blockchain-based logging where each transaction is immutably recorded, ensuring tamper-proof records.
  • Adopt decentralized dispute resolution mechanisms backed by smart contracts to verify fair play automatically.

Regular security audits and incorporating cryptography best practices are vital in safeguarding transaction processes.

Weaknesses in User Authentication and Account Security

Common Password and Credential Management Mistakes

User accounts are a common target for attacks. Many users choose weak passwords, reuse passwords across platforms, or neglect to update credentials regularly. According to a 2020 report by the Cybersecurity Lab, over 80% of breaches in online wallets involved credential reuse or weak passwords. To better protect your online assets, it’s important to stay informed about security best practices. You can learn more about secure gaming environments at http://dragonia.games/.

  • Enforce complex password policies and regular updates.
  • Encourage the use of password managers to generate and store strong passwords.
  • Implement account lockout policies after multiple failed login attempts.

Two-Factor Authentication Challenges in Crypto Platforms

2FA adds an extra layer of security but is often poorly implemented. Users might rely on SMS-based 2FA, which is susceptible to SIM swapping attacks. Additionally, during platform outages, 2FA mechanisms may become inaccessible, locking users out of their accounts.

Time-based one-time passwords (TOTP) and hardware tokens provide more secure alternatives, but require better implementation and user education.

Implementing Robust User Verification Protocols

Platform operators should adopt multi-layered verification: combining email verification, biometric checks, and identity verification through KYC procedures. Continuous monitoring of account activity for anomalies is essential to prevent unauthorized access and phishing attempts.

Artificial intelligence-powered fraud detection systems can analyze login patterns, flagging suspicious behavior proactively.

Risks Associated with Smart Contract Exploits and Platform Code

Common Smart Contract Vulnerabilities in Gambling Apps

Smart contracts govern many blockchain-based gambling platforms, but their complexity can introduce vulnerabilities. Known issues include reentrancy attacks (exploited in the infamous DAO hack), integer overflows, and logic errors. In 2016, the DAO’s smart contract flaw allowed an attacker to drain 3.6 million ETH.

Code Audit and Continuous Security Testing Practices

Periodic audits by independent security firms are necessary to identify vulnerabilities. Automated tools like Mythril and Oyente can detect reentrancy and overflow issues. Implementing formal verification and bug bounty programs encourages community testing and faster discovery of vulnerabilities.

Ensuring Transparency and Open-Source Code Use

Open-source code enables community review, fostering transparency. Platforms like Augur and Gnosis have built trust through public, auditable smart contract code. Always release code repositories publicly and engage with auditors and developers for ongoing improvements.

In conclusion, securing Bitcoin gambling platforms demands a multi-layered approach. From wallet management to smart contract integrity, understanding and addressing these common vulnerabilities empowers operators and users alike to minimize risk and promote a safer gambling environment.